By Product Type The market is primarily divided into two major types of pearlescent pigments: Titanium Dioxide-based Pearlescent Pigments : Dominating the market, these pigments offer a high level of opacity and brightness, making them suitable for applications requiring superior color quality. This type of pigment is expected to continue leading due to its wide applicability in coatings, cosmetics, and plastics. Bismuth Oxychloride Pearlescent Pigments : Known for their bright, high-impact shine, these pigments are increasingly used in cosmetics and personal care products, especially in the creation of luxurious finishes for high-end makeup and skincare products. While titanium dioxide-based pigments maintain the largest market share due to their versatility and performance, bismuth oxychloride pigments are experiencing faster growth, especially in the cosmetics sector where shimmer and reflective qualities are highly valued. Innovations in Production Technology Advances in production techniques have led to more efficient manufacturing processes for pearlescent pigments. New technologies such as sol-gel technology and nanotechnology are being explored to create pigments with enhanced color effects, better stability, and increased durability. Sol-gel technology allows for the creation of high-performance pearlescent pigments that are more resistant to environmental factors such as UV radiation, which is particularly important in automotive and exterior coatings. On the other hand, nanoparticles are being incorporated into pearlescent pigments to achieve finer particle sizes, leading to a more uniform and vibrant appearance. These innovations improve the visual effects and the overall longevity of products in which pearlescent pigments are used. Growth of Functional Pigments The market is also witnessing the rise of functional pearlescent pigments , which offer more than just aesthetic appeal. These pigments can provide additional benefits such as UV protection , anti-microbial properties , or heat resistance , expanding their application into diverse industries. For instance, pearlescent pigments with UV-protective properties are being used in automotive coatings and cosmetics, offering dual functionality—enhancing appearance while also protecting surfaces from the damaging effects of UV radiation. Similarly, the development of anti-microbial pearlescent pigments for use in products like plastics, paints , and coatings is gaining traction in industries where hygiene is a priority, such as healthcare and food packaging. By integrating functionality with aesthetics, pearlescent pigments are becoming more versatile and appealing to industries seeking to offer multi-dimensional products to consumers. Restraints High Production Costs While the demand for high-quality pearlescent pigments continues to rise, the production costs for premium-grade pearlescent pigments remain relatively high. This is particularly challenging in regions with price-sensitive markets where cost optimization is critical. The price of raw materials, such as titanium dioxide and bismuth oxychloride, can significantly impact the final cost of pearlescent pigments, potentially limiting their use in low-cost applications and limiting market expansion in emerging economies. Limited Availability of Eco-Friendly Alternatives Despite the growing demand for eco-friendly and sustainable pearlescent pigments, the availability of bio-based or low-toxic alternatives remains limited. The production of bio-based pigments requires significant R&D investment, and companies that can develop cost-effective sustainable options will have a competitive advantage. However, the higher production cost of these sustainable alternatives may limit their widespread adoption in certain sectors, especially consumer goods and packaging, where margins are tight. Regulatory Compliance Challenges Regulatory frameworks, such as the REACH regulations in Europe, are becoming stricter regarding the use of heavy metals and other harmful substances in pigments. Manufacturers need to invest heavily in research and development to ensure their products comply with these regulations. Companies that fail to comply may face penalties or restrictions on sales, which can hinder growth in certain regions, especially where regulatory standards are high.
